German Vocabulary for Conversational Level B2348
Conversational German at level B2 represents a significant milestone in language proficiency. Individuals with this level of proficiency can engage in complex discussions, express their opinions and ideas clearly, and understand a wide range of spoken and written content.
Vocabulary for Everyday Situations
At B2 level, you will master vocabulary related to various everyday situations. This includes terms for:
Shopping (Einkauf): Artikel, Kasse, bezahlen
Transportation (Verkehr): Bahnhof, Busbahnhof, Fahrkarte
Health and well-being (Gesundheit und Wohlbefinden): Arzt, Krankenhaus, Medikamente
Social interactions (Soziale Kontakte): treffen, verabreden, einladen
Travel and tourism (Reise und Tourismus): Reisebüro, Hotel, Sightseeing
Vocabulary for Cultural and Social Topics
B2 proficiency also entails vocabulary related to cultural and social issues. You will be able to discuss:
Current events (Aktuelles): Nachrichten, Politik, Umwelt
History and culture (Geschichte und Kultur): Museum, Theater, Kunst
Education (Bildung): Universität, Schule, Studium
li>Work and career (Beruf und Karriere): Bewerbung, Gehalt, Karriereleiter
Vocabulary for Expressing Opinions and Emotions
Conveying your opinions and emotions effectively is crucial in B2-level communication. You will acquire vocabulary for:
Expressing opinions (Meinungen äußern): meiner Meinung nach, ich glaube, ich bezweifle
Expressing emotions (Gefühle ausdrücken): glücklich, traurig, wütend
Agreeing and disagreeing (Zustimmung und Ablehnung): Ich stimme zu, ich bin anderer Meinung
Making suggestions (Vorschläge machen): Ich schlage vor, wir könnten
Vocabulary for Describing and Discussing Complex Topics
B2 proficiency enables you to discuss complex topics in detail. This involves vocabulary for:
Describing events (Ereignisse beschreiben): geschehen, passieren, stattfinden
Causality and consequences (Ursache und Wirkung): weil, deshalb, deswegen
Comparing and contrasting (Vergleichen und Gegenüberstellen): ähnlich, verschieden, hingegen
Speculating and hypothesizing (Vermuten und Hypothesen aufstellen): vielleicht, möglicherweise, angenommen
Advanced Vocabulary for Specific Domains
Depending on your interests and professional needs, you may also want to focus on vocabulary in specific domains, such as:
Business (Wirtschaft): Marketing, Finanzen, Management
Technology (Technik): Computer, Internet, Software
Science (Wissenschaft): Naturwissenschaften, Mathematik
Law (Recht): Gesetz, Vertrag, Prozess
Tips for Expanding Your Vocabulary
Expanding your vocabulary is an ongoing process. Here are some tips:
Read widely in German: Novels, newspapers, magazines
Watch German films and TV shows
Listen to German music and podcasts
Use language learning apps and flashcards
Engage in conversation with native German speakers
By consistently incorporating these strategies into your language learning journey, you can significantly enhance your German vocabulary and achieve B2 conversational fluency.
